Deputy FM Chatzivasileiou meets with visiting US Congress delegation
- Written by E.Tsiliopoulos
Deputy Foreign Affairs Minister Tasos Chatzivasileiou, responsible for Economic Diplomacy and Extroversion, met on Wednesday with a visiting US Congress delegation.
Both sides reaffirmed the historically excellent relations between Greece and the United States, and discussed bilateral cooperation and the challenges the global community faces. At the same time, both sides discussed Greece's strategy in extroversion and the attraction of investments.
Chatzivasileiou underlined that Greece is a responsible force of stability in the East Mediterranean and a reliable partner for the future of economic cooperation and geopolitical stability.
